Accessing and Navigating the Obituary Section
Finding obituaries in the Minneapolis Star Tribune is generally straightforward, both online and in print. The online platform usually offers a search function where you can enter the name of the deceased, keywords related to their life, or specific dates. This makes it easier to locate a particular obituary quickly. The online archives often extend back many years, providing a historical record of lives lived in the region. For those who prefer the tactile experience of reading a physical newspaper, the Minneapolis Star Tribune typically includes an obituaries section in its print edition. This section is usually organized by date and provides a snapshot of recent deaths. Keep in mind that some obituaries may appear online but not in print, or vice versa, so checking both sources is often a good idea. Navigating these resources efficiently ensures that you can find the information you seek and pay your respects to those who have passed.
The Significance of Obituaries
Obituaries play a crucial role in society, serving as more than just announcements of death. They are, first and foremost, a formal acknowledgment of a person's life and passing. This acknowledgment provides closure for family and friends, allowing them to publicly mourn and celebrate the individual's memory. Furthermore, obituaries act as historical documents, preserving valuable information about individuals and their contributions to society. Genealogists and researchers often rely on obituaries to trace family histories and understand the social dynamics of past generations. Beyond their practical functions, obituaries offer a space for collective mourning and remembrance, strengthening community bonds. They remind us of our shared humanity and the importance of cherishing the lives of those around us. Writing and Submitting an Obituary
Writing an obituary can be a daunting task, especially during a time of grief. However, it's also a meaningful opportunity to honor the life of the deceased. When writing an obituary for the Minneapolis Star Tribune, it's helpful to gather key information, such as the person's full name, date of birth, date of death, and place of death. Including details about their family, education, career, and hobbies can paint a more complete picture of their life. You might also want to mention significant accomplishments, awards, or contributions they made to their community. When submitting the obituary, be sure to follow the Star Tribune's guidelines regarding length, format, and deadlines. Most newspapers charge a fee for publishing obituaries, so it's important to inquire about the costs involved. Some funeral homes offer obituary writing and submission services as part of their arrangements, which can ease the burden on grieving families. Remember, the goal is to create a respectful and informative tribute that captures the essence of the person's life.
Exploring Beyond Traditional Obituaries
In addition to traditional obituaries, the Minneapolis Star Tribune and other online platforms offer various ways to remember and celebrate the lives of loved ones. Online memorial pages allow family and friends to share photos, videos, and memories, creating a collaborative tribute that extends beyond the written word. Guest books provide a space for people to express their condolences and offer support to the bereaved. Some websites also feature virtual candles or other symbolic gestures of remembrance. These online resources can be particularly helpful for those who are unable to attend a funeral or memorial service in person. They offer a way to connect with others who are grieving and share in the collective mourning process. Exploring these alternative forms of remembrance can provide comfort and solace during a difficult time.
